韩国服务器,韩国服务器目前负载过高怎么办
在当今数字化时代,服务器的性能和稳定性对于企业和个人的在线业务至关重要。韩国服务器作为一种常见的选择,在某些情况下可能会面临负载过高的问题。本文将探讨韩国服务器负载过高的原因以及解决方法,帮助您优化服务器性能,确保业务的正常运行。
一、韩国服务器负载过高的原因
韩国服务器负载过高可能由多种因素引起。以下是一些常见的原因:
1. 流量突然增加:如果您的网站或应用程序突然受到大量的访问流量,服务器可能会不堪重负。这可能是由于促销活动、热门新闻事件或社交媒体的传播等原因导致的。
2. 资源密集型应用程序:某些应用程序,如视频流媒体、大型数据库操作或高并发的 Web 应用程序,可能会消耗大量的服务器资源,导致负载过高。
3. 硬件配置不足:如果服务器的硬件配置不足以满足当前的业务需求,例如内存不足、CPU 性能低下或存储容量有限,也会导致负载过高的问题。
4. 软件问题:服务器上运行的软件可能存在漏洞或错误,导致资源浪费和性能下降。例如,操作系统的配置不当、应用程序的错误代码或数据库的查询优化不足等。
5. 网络问题:网络连接不稳定、带宽不足或网络延迟过高也可能影响服务器的性能,导致负载过高的情况出现。
二、解决韩国服务器负载过高的方法
当您发现韩国服务器负载过高时,可以采取以下措施来解决问题:
1. 优化服务器配置
- 升级硬件:根据服务器的负载情况,考虑升级内存、CPU、存储等硬件设备,以提高服务器的性能。
- 调整操作系统参数:优化操作系统的配置,如内存管理、进程调度和网络设置等,以提高系统的性能和资源利用率。
- 安装性能优化工具:使用一些性能优化工具,如监控软件、缓存工具和负载均衡器等,来实时监测服务器的性能并进行优化。
2. 优化应用程序
- 代码优化:检查应用程序的代码,优化算法和数据结构,减少不必要的计算和资源消耗。
- 数据库优化:对数据库进行优化,如索引优化、查询优化和表结构设计等,以提高数据库的查询性能和响应时间。
- 缓存机制:使用缓存技术,如页面缓存、数据缓存和对象缓存等,减少对服务器资源的重复请求,提高应用程序的性能。
3. 流量管理
- 限流策略:实施限流措施,限制并发请求的数量,避免服务器因流量过大而崩溃。可以通过设置阈值和排队机制来控制流量的进入。
- 内容分发网络(CDN):使用 CDN 来分担服务器的流量压力,将静态内容分发到全球各地的缓存服务器上,提高内容的加载速度和用户体验。
- 弹性扩展:根据流量的变化,采用弹性扩展的方式,自动增加或减少服务器资源,以满足业务的需求。
4. 监控和预警
- 建立监控系统:安装监控软件,实时监测服务器的性能指标,如 CPU 利用率、内存使用率、磁盘空间和网络流量等。通过监控数据及时发现问题并采取相应的措施。
- 设置预警机制:根据监控指标设置预警阈值,当服务器负载超过一定限度时,及时发送警报通知管理员,以便及时处理问题。
5. 排查和解决软件问题
- 检查软件更新:确保服务器上运行的操作系统、应用程序和数据库等软件都是最新版本,以修复可能存在的漏洞和错误。
- 日志分析:分析服务器的日志文件,查找可能存在的错误信息和异常情况,以便及时排查和解决问题。
- 性能测试:定期进行性能测试,发现潜在的性能问题,并进行优化和改进。
三、预防韩国服务器负载过高的措施
除了及时解决服务器负载过高的问题外,采取一些预防措施可以有效地避免负载过高的情况发生:
1. 合理规划资源
- 根据业务需求,合理评估服务器的资源需求,包括硬件配置和带宽等,确保服务器能够满足未来的发展需求。
- 制定资源规划和预算,避免过度投资或资源不足的情况发生。
2. 定期维护和优化
- 定期对服务器进行维护,包括硬件检查、软件更新和系统优化等,确保服务器的性能和稳定性。
- 建立维护计划和流程,定期进行备份和数据清理,以保证服务器的健康运行。
3. 测试和演练
- 在上线前进行充分的测试,包括性能测试、压力测试和安全测试等,确保应用程序和服务器能够正常运行。
- 定期进行灾难恢复演练,提高应对突发情况的能力,确保业务的连续性。
4. 监控和评估
- 持续监控服务器的性能和业务指标,根据监控数据进行评估和分析,及时发现问题并进行调整。
- 建立性能评估指标体系,定期对服务器的性能进行评估和优化。
总之,韩国服务器负载过高是一个需要及时解决的问题。通过了解负载过高的原因,并采取相应的解决方法和预防措施,您可以优化服务器性能,提高业务的稳定性和用户体验。同时,定期的监控和维护也是确保服务器长期稳定运行的关键。希望本文对您有所帮助,祝您的业务顺利发展!